Optimal pricing strategies for manufacturing-as-a service platforms to ensure business sustainability

Author

Listed:
  • Chaudhuri, Atanu
  • Datta, Partha Priya
  • Fernandes, Kiran J.
  • Xiong, Yu

Abstract

Manufacturing as a Service (MaaS) is a service which delivers manufactured products by connecting its network of suppliers with its customers on a digital platform. The long term sustainability of the MaaS platforms depends on their pricing strategy and whether they can generate sufficient volume from customers and encourage suppliers to do business with them.
